## Runbook: LiftSim dispatch simulator

LiftSim models elevator dispatch for the Hargrove Tower demos. If simulations stall, restart the scheduler worker first; nine times out of ten that clears it. Stuck car states mean a corrupted scenario file — reload from the scenario library, don't hand-edit. Escalate only if restarts fail twice. Verify the running instance against the expected configuration values listed here:

service settings:
[eliax]
port = 6379
region = lower-4
host = eliax.paliqlabs.corp
timeout_ms = 750
retries = 3

Scope: plugin authors locked out of the Restokka vending-machine restock planner sandbox. Do not create a new account; route mappings and machine inventories are bound to the original. Steps: confirm the plugin ID still appears in the registry, request an unlock from the Restokka partner desk, then wait for the sandbox to cycle (about five minutes). Planner state, including pending restock routes, survives recovery intact. The final unlock step prompts once for the recovery passphrase listed directly below.

recovery phrase for bawep-kawef: oliath-casdor

Runbook 22-F: Medical Cooler Runs. Coolers for the Brackenvale field clinic are packed by the Ostermere pharmacy team with ice packs rated for six hours. Records team verifies the temperature strip and seal number at dispatch and again on return. No stops en route. At the clinic tent, the courier completes hand-over per the line below.

handover note for yagef-bagep: the drudor pelius courier leaves the kasdor zorvan norir ledger at gate 8016 under passcode 755406

## Alert: StatRelay Sidecar Flush Lag

This alert fires when the StatRelay metrics-aggregation sidecar falls more than 120 seconds behind on flushing buffered samples to the Coalmine backend. Plugin-emitted counters are buffered in-process, so sustained lag usually means a plugin is emitting unbounded label cardinality or blocking the flush thread. Check your plugin's metric registration against the published cardinality limits before escalating. If the lag persists after your plugin is ruled out, contact the telemetry team.

escalation mailbox, bagug-fahof: novdor.wendor.jormir@norvalabs.example